Currently this perceptual concept of “openness to the globe” is very different from the psychoanalytic concept of “regression to primary-method thought,” even within the service of the ego. Primary-method thought, argues Schachtel, “uses freely displaceable cathexes within the unrestrained tendency toward full discharge of the strain of id drives by the trail of (phantasied or hallucinated) want fulfillment, that is, within the service of the striving to return to a tensionless state. . . .

What the early stages of the artistic method have in common with such reveries is principally the very fact that they, too, wander freely without being certain by the foundations and properties of the accepted, standard, familiar everyday world. During this free wandering they center, but, on the article, idea, drawback that is the focus of the artistic endeavor. . . .” The essential distinction between the psychoanalytic and also the perceptual formulation, as Schachtel points out, is that where the one conceives of creativity as because of a “drive discharge perform,” the other conceives of it as because of an “openness within the encounter with the world.” In a very sense, if we tend to wished to put the problem in extreme type, for the one artistic behavior is seen as tension-reducing, for the other as tension-seeking.
There’s no doubt that Schachtel poses the issues in another and useful light, and an essential question could now be reformulated.
